The mission of the Jefferson/Franklin Consortium is to establish and maintain strong partnerships between business, economic development, education and the local workforce development system to connect employers to a skilled workforce. We also provide free talent recruitment, talent development, and other workforce development services for employers. Our mission is to provide innovative workforce solutions that maximize the potential of job seekers and employers resulting in a stronger workforce development ecosystem for our region.

Missouri Certified Work Ready Community (CWRC) Initiative

The Certified Work Ready Community (CWRC) initiative in Missouri is an effort to align workforce and education to meet the economic needs of the state and local communities. It is guided by key community leaders; elected officials, economic development, business leaders, chambers of commerce, educators and workforce development, in each county. The vision for the Certified Work Ready Communities is to attract, retain, and develop a workforce with education and fundamental skills to succeed in the 21st Century.
Jefferson and Franklin Counties have been recognized as one of the strongest Certified Work Ready Community (CWRC) workforce regions in the country. Having Certified WorkReady Communities will result in strengthening existing businesses and developing a stronger workforce for our region.
To maintain our Certified WorkReady status, employers are asked to reaffirm their support of this important initiative. The Jefferson-Franklin Employment Consortium will work in partnership with employers to maintain our Certified Work Ready Communities (CWRC) certifications and would like to THANK YOU for your support.
